Abstract

Раскрыта насосная система (10) для трубопровода (100), включающая в себя насос (12), выполненный с возможностью присоединения к подающей трубе (101) и отводной трубе (102) трубопровода (100). Система (10) дополнительно включает в себя, сокращающее поток устройство (22), образующее в одном варианте осуществления часть задвижки (14), функционирующее для выборочной установки множества ограниченных каналов (30) потока на первом участке (105) отводной трубы (102). Ограниченные каналы (30) потока увеличивают сопротивление потоку среды на первом участке отводной трубы, чтобы ограничить скорость потока среды, отбираемой насосом (12) ниже порогового уровня. Также раскрыты задвижка (14) и элемент задвижки (22) . Система (10) имеет конкретное применение при добыче полезных ископаемых, при этом также раскрыты способы управления работой насоса и подгонки насосной системы.A pumping system (10) for the pipeline (100) is disclosed, including a pump (12) adapted to be connected to the feed pipe (101) and the discharge pipe (102) of the pipeline (100). The system (10) additionally includes a flow reducing device (22), forming in one embodiment a part of the valve (14), functioning to selectively install a plurality of restricted flow channels (30) in the first section (105) of the discharge pipe (102). The restricted flow channels (30) increase the resistance to the flow of the medium in the first section of the branch pipe in order to limit the flow rate of the medium taken by the pump (12) below the threshold level. The valve (14) and the valve element (22) are also disclosed. The system (10) has a specific application in the extraction of minerals, and the methods of controlling the operation of the pump and the fitting of the pumping system are also disclosed.
